Security practices
Application data is encrypted at rest — database volumes and evidence storage alike — and in transit over TLS 1.3. Every account can turn on multi-factor authentication, and every database query is scoped to your organization, with no cross-tenant access path. Signing and encryption keys are held as access-controlled platform secrets, never checked into code or images. Your application data — accounts, websites, audits, findings — is stored and processed on Fly.io in Frankfurt, Germany (region fra), inside the EU. Sealed evidence bundles are stored separately in Cloudflare R2 under EU jurisdiction. AI classification is one step that sends content abroad: Anthropic receives only the minimal signals needed for classification, never credentials, billing data, or raw evidence files, and never issues the final compliance verdict itself. 7 of our 9 named subprocessors have a US data flow — Anthropic among them — each listed with exactly what it receives.

Evidence integrity
Complicer does not hold SOC 2 or ISO 27001 certification. We will not claim either until it is formally awarded — we would rather tell you exactly what we do than badge a control nobody has independently audited.
Instead, every audit is sealed as evidence you can check yourself. Each artifact is hashed with SHA-256 at capture time, so any later change to a single byte breaks the hash. The manifest is signed with an Ed25519 key, binding it to Complicer. Our timestamping is RFC 3161-ready: when a Time-Stamping Authority is configured, it countersigns the bundle; otherwise the bundle carries a local timestamp, and the report states which was used — we never claim active third-party timestamping we haven't turned on. Separately, every audit-log entry chains to the one before it by hash, so a tampered or deleted entry breaks the chain. Every regulator export ships with an offline verifier script — plain Node.js, no dependency on our servers — so your DPO, or a regulator, can re-check the evidence independently.
Uptime & status
We don't yet publish a public uptime history. Operational monitoring includes a synthetic audit canary that runs end-to-end audits against a live site multiple times a day, with alerting the moment one stops completing.
